Solution

The correct option is A A.P.
We have,

(b−c)x2+(c−a)x+(a−b)=0

Comparing with the quadratic equation

Ax2+Bx+C=0

A=(b−c),B=c−a,C=a−b

Discriminate when roots are equal

D=B2−4AC=0

D=(c−a)2−4(b−c)(a−b)=0

D=(c2+a2−2ac)−4(ba−ac−b2+bc)=0

D=c2+a2−2ac−4ab+4ac+4b2−4bc=0

c2+a2+2ac−4b(a+c)+4b2=0

(a+c)2−4b(a+c)+4b2=0

[(a+c)−2b]2=0

a+c=2b

So,

a,b,c are in A.P
